jankasl.com is the official website for Hájovna Bradačka, a holiday cottage in the South Bohemian region of the Czech Republic. It offers weekly rental of an entire countryside cottage. The property is located in a forest about 9 km from the historic city center of Tábor, with an emphasis on quiet surroundings, privacy, nature, and access to a private fishing pond.
The site mainly presents property details, pricing, available dates, amenities, address information, and contact methods. The cottage accommodates 8 to 10 people and includes a living room fireplace, a full kitchen, two bathrooms, a washing machine, mobile internet, a TV, and satellite reception. Outdoors, there is a garden, terrace, children’s play area, outdoor fireplace, and a private stocked fish pond of about 2.5 hectares, where guests can fish for carp, grass carp, pike, zander, and other species, or swim. The rental price also includes fishing, firewood, use of two adult bicycles, two children’s bicycles, and a boat.
Pricing is charged by the week: 21,700 Czech koruna in July and August, 28,000 Czech koruna for Christmas and New Year, and 13,300 Czech koruna in other months. The page also lists a September special price of 14,700 Czech koruna. A 20% deposit must be paid to a bank account within 30 days after booking, with the remaining balance paid on arrival. A 3,000 Czech koruna security deposit is also collected at check-in and refunded if the property is returned undamaged. For groups of more than 8 people, each additional adult is charged 800 Czech koruna per week.
